创建一个包含文件名的数组

2025-05-24 AI文章 阅读 2

使用PowerShell重命名文件

在Windows操作系统中,有时我们需要批量处理大量文件,进行重命名操作,而PowerShell作为微软的命令行界面脚本语言,提供了一种高效、灵活的方式来执行这些任务,本文将介绍如何使用PowerShell来重命名文件。

基本语法和功能

基本语法

在PowerShell中,重命名文件的基本语法如下:

Rename-Item -Path "原路径" -NewName "新名称"

这里,“原路径”是指要修改名称的文件的实际位置,“新名称”是你希望给该文件的新名称。

多文件操作

如果你需要同时重命名多个文件,可以使用数组或循环结构。

    "C:\path\to\file1.txt",
    "C:\path\to\file2.docx",
    "C:\path\to\file3.xlsx"
)
foreach ($file in $files) {
    Rename-Item -Path $file -NewName "renamed_$($file.Name)"
}

高级功能

确保文件存在

你可能只想更改那些实际存在的文件,而不改变那些不存在的临时文件,你可以通过以下方式避免这个问题:

if (Test-Path $newFilePath) {
    Rename-Item -Path $oldFilePath -NewName $newFileName
} else {
    Write-Host "$newFilePath does not exist."
}

自动化和定时任务

PowerShell的强大之处在于其脚本的可重复性和自动化能力,你可以编写脚本来自动完成一系列文件重命名工作,并设置为定期运行的任务(如每天一次)。

注意事项

  • 备份重要数据:在执行大规模文件重命名之前,请确保有完整的备份,以防万一。
  • 权限问题:某些情况下,你需要具有足够的权限才能重命名文件,检查并确保你的用户账户有足够的权限。
  • 错误处理:添加适当的错误处理代码以应对可能发生的异常情况,比如文件不存在时的错误处理。

使用PowerShell重命名文件是一种非常有效且灵活的方法,特别是在处理大量文件时,通过上述步骤,你可以轻松地实现文件重命名,提高工作效率,合理利用PowerShell的功能可以帮助你更好地管理你的计算机资源和数据。

相关推荐

  • 黑盒测试工具及其应用详解

    在软件开发和质量保证的过程中,确保系统的功能性和稳定性是一个复杂而重要的任务,黑盒测试是一种基于输入数据的行为测试方法,它关注的是程序的输出结果而不是内部逻辑,为了有效执行黑盒测试,使用合适的测试工具是非常必要的,本文将详细介绍几种常用的黑盒测试工具,并探讨它们的应用场...

    0AI文章2025-05-24
  • 产品防护的基本要求

    在数字化和网络化的时代,产品的安全保护变得尤为重要,无论是在物理世界还是虚拟空间中,任何产品都面临着被黑客攻击、数据泄露等威胁的风险,确保产品的安全性和可靠性成为了一个不容忽视的问题,本文将探讨产品防护的基本要求,旨在为产品制造商提供一些建议和指南。 安全设计原则...

    0AI文章2025-05-24
  • 防策反、防渗透与防泄密—构筑网络安全的三重防线

    在当今数字化时代,信息安全已经成为企业和组织不可忽视的重要议题,随着技术的发展和网络攻击手段的不断变化,如何有效地防止内部人员或外部威胁者进行策反、渗透和泄密成为了企业安全防护的关键环节,本文将从三个主要方面出发,探讨如何构建有效的防策反、防渗透与防泄密体系。 防策反...

    0AI文章2025-05-24
  • 网页点击发送验证码没反应的原因分析与解决策略

    在当今互联网时代,我们经常需要通过电子邮件、短信或网页验证来保护我们的账户安全,有时候即使按照正确的方法进行操作,也可能会遇到网页点击发送验证码后没有反应的情况,本文将详细分析这种现象可能的原因,并提供相应的解决方案。 服务器问题 原因: 当前的网络环境和服务器...

    0AI文章2025-05-24
  • 金苹果排名,教育与创新的双翼

    在当今快速发展的科技时代,教育作为培养未来社会栋梁的关键,其重要性不言而喻,如何在众多教育资源中脱颖而出,成为学生和家长的选择之首?“金苹果排名”应运而生,旨在为教育行业提供一套全面、公正且具有前瞻性的评价体系。 什么是“金苹果排名” “金苹果排名”是一个基于教育质...

    0AI文章2025-05-24
  • 限期整改原则不得超过60日

    在任何管理或行政流程中,“限期整改”是一项基本且重要的原则,这一原则强调了对违规行为的及时纠正和处理,以确保系统的正常运行和效率提升,在实践中,许多机构和组织常常忽视这一原则的限制,导致问题积压、整改周期过长,甚至出现“整改无果”的情况。 什么是限期整改? 限期整改...

    0AI文章2025-05-24
  • 港澳电话漫游收费标准解析,合理使用,避免高额费用

    在当今全球化的今天,随着跨境通信需求的增加,香港和澳门作为中国与世界各地联系的重要桥梁,吸引了越来越多的国际用户,在享受这些便捷服务的同时,如何合理地管理电话漫游费用成为了一个重要问题,本文将详细探讨香港、澳门地区的电话漫游收费标准,帮助您更好地理解和规划您的跨国通信预...

    0AI文章2025-05-24
  • 探索黑帽AI技术的潜在风险与应对策略

    随着人工智能(AI)技术的飞速发展,它在各个领域的应用越来越广泛,在这股技术浪潮中,“黑帽”AI技术也逐渐浮出水面,成为了一种新的威胁,本文将深入探讨“黑帽”AI的技术特点、潜在风险以及如何防范和应对。 黑帽AI技术概述 “黑帽”AI是一种利用AI技术进行非法或不道...

    0AI文章2025-05-24
  • 漏洞的由来与分类

    在计算机科学中,“漏洞”是一个非常重要的概念,它指的是软件或系统设计中的缺陷,这些缺陷可能导致安全风险和数据泄露,理解什么是漏洞以及如何识别它们对于保护网络安全至关重要。 什么是漏洞? 漏洞是指存在于应用程序、操作系统或其他系统组件中的未被发现或未被充分处理的安全问...

    0AI文章2025-05-24
  • 解决网页支付不跳转支付页面的问题

    在电子商务和在线购物领域,确保用户能够顺利完成交易过程是至关重要的,有时候会出现一个问题——用户在进行支付操作时,浏览器并不会自动跳转到指定的支付页面,这种情况不仅影响用户体验,还可能导致订单无法正常提交或被系统误判为无效支付。 本文将探讨如何解决这个问题,并提供一些...

    0AI文章2025-05-24